Several factors are fueling the growth of the trans-4-hydroxycinnamic acid market. The increasing prevalence of chronic diseases and the growing demand for natural and effective therapeutic agents are significantly boosting the adoption of t-4-HCA in the pharmaceutical industry. Its antioxidant and anti-inflammatory properties are highly sought after for developing novel drug formulations and dietary supplements. Simultaneously, the agricultural sector is witnessing a surge in the use of t-4-HCA as a natural pesticide and growth enhancer, driven by the global shift towards sustainable and eco-friendly farming practices. The cosmetics industry is also embracing t-4-HCA for its potential skin-beneficial properties, incorporating it into skincare products designed to combat aging and protect against environmental damage. Furthermore, emerging applications in electronics, such as in the development of conductive polymers, contribute to the market's overall expansion. This multifaceted demand across various sectors ensures a consistently strong and diversified market for t-4-HCA, promising continued growth in the coming years. Government initiatives promoting sustainable agriculture and the development of natural alternatives to synthetic chemicals further support the market's positive trajectory.
Despite the considerable growth potential, the trans-4-hydroxycinnamic acid market faces several challenges. The fluctuating prices of raw materials, particularly those sourced from agricultural origins, can significantly impact production costs and profitability. Ensuring a consistent and reliable supply chain is crucial for sustained market growth, particularly given the increasing global demand. Furthermore, the complexity of t-4-HCA extraction and purification processes can contribute to higher production costs compared to synthetic alternatives. Strict regulatory requirements related to food safety and environmental protection also impose compliance burdens on manufacturers. Competition from synthetic substitutes, often more affordable and readily available, poses a significant threat to the market share of natural t-4-HCA. Overcoming these challenges requires continuous innovation in production processes, exploring cost-effective extraction methods, and maintaining a close collaboration with regulatory bodies to ensure compliance and market access. Lastly, the need for robust quality control measures is vital to maintain the reputation of t-4-HCA as a high-quality and reliable ingredient.
